How many amps typical ceiling fan?

How many amps typical ceiling fan? The majority of modern ceiling fans use less than an amp, averaging between 0.5 and 1 amp, depending on the model and the setting. One amp drawn by a ceiling fan is equivalent to about 120 watts. Low settings use less amperage while higher settings use more.

How many ceiling fans can be on a 15 amp circuit? 1 Answer. There should be no problem running 4 ceiling fans on a single 15 ampere circuit, though it will depend on what else is on the circuit. Say a 52″ fan is 90-100 watts (at high speed), plus three 60 watt bulbs. That puts each fixture at 280 watts or so.

Does a ceiling fan need a 20 amp circuit? According to the NEC (National Electrical Code), every room should have at least one dedicated 20-amp circuit installed inside it (for receptacles), plus one dedicated 15-amp circuit (for lighting).

How much does it cost to run a fan for 24 hours? In the US, the average 20 inch box fan costs $0.013 cents per hour. This works out at $0.104 per 8 hours (e.g. overnight) and $0.31 over 24hrs. If on 24/7, the average 20 inch box fan costs $2.18 per week or $9.65 per month to run.

How get lightbulb out of ceiling exhaust fan?

Screws: Look for screws on the outside of your exhaust fan cover near the plastic or glass panel that covers your light bulb. Just unscrew them to remove the cover and access the light bulb. Nuts: Sometimes, your light cover might have a single nut in the center that secures it.

When did asbestos stop being used in ceilings?

In 1977, the U.S. Government banned the use of asbestos in ceiling finishes, and most ceilings installed after this date will not contain asbestos. It is still possible, however, that materials manufactured before 1977 were installed in homes after the ban.

How should i set my ceiling fan in the summer?

During summer months, your ceiling fan blades should be set to spin counterclockwise. When your ceiling fan spins quickly in this direction, it pushes air down and creates a cool breeze. This helps keep a room’s temperature consistent throughout the day and reduces the need for an air conditioner to run constantly.

Why are most ceilings textured?

The texturing hides imperfections very effectively. It helps eliminate echo in a room. If you have ever talked in a room before and after carpeting, you know what a big difference carpet makes on echoes. An acoustic finish is like carpeting the ceiling.

How to clean bathroom ceiling vents?

Clean Exhaust Fan Vent Cover: Soak the vent cover in a tub of hot soapy water while you clean the exhaust fan blades. Use a damp microfiber cloth to scrub away caked-on dust and grime. Air-dry the vent cover completely before reassembly.

How to hide a beam in the ceiling?

A drywall cover makes the beam virtually disappear into the ceiling, making it look more like a soffit than a beam. Secure the drywall directly to the beam, tape and cover all the nails and corners. Add texture with drywall mud to match the ceilings and walls. When dry, paint the beam to match the ceilings and walls.

Is my ceiling made of asbestos?

Unfortunately, you generally can’t tell whether a popcorn ceiling contains asbestos by examining it visually. If your home was built before the mid-1980s, there’s a good chance your popcorn ceiling has asbestos in it. The best way to determine if asbestos is present is to have your ceiling professionally tested.

What kind of paint finish for kitchen ceiling?

Choose an eggshell finish, which is about as shiny as an actual eggshell, for a more durable coating that doesn’t shine much. A satin or semi-gloss paint is even easier to clean, but will show off a lot of the ceiling’s flaws. If your ceiling is perfectly smooth, satin or semi-gloss are suitable options.

Why do you need a capacitor in a ceiling fan?

The capacitor is used not only to start the fan but also to make it spin. In simple words, the capacitor creates a magnetic flux (torque) which makes the fan rotate. Generally, two capacitors in parallel series are used in the ceiling fan. … In other words, a fan will have a single-phase induction motor in it.

What is special about ceiling paint?

Ceiling paint offers strong adhesion to a variety of textured surfaces such as stucco, drywall, and plaster. It’s also more durable than many types of wall paint and doesn’t crack or peel. You’ll find that you have a choice of water-based (latex) or oil-based ceiling paint as well.

How to remove soda stains from car ceiling?

Step 1: Use a clean cloth to blot up as much of the spilled soda as possible. Step 2: Mix one tablespoon dishwashing liquid and one tablespoon of white vinegar with a cup and a half of water. Step 3: Use a clean cloth or sponge to rub and blot the stain with the dishwashing liquid and vinegar solution.

How many stairs for a 10 foot ceiling?

A staircase in a home with 10′ ceilings requires 17 steps. Stairs that have a tread depth of 11” will have a total length of 187”. Stairs with a tread depth of 10” will have a total length of 170”, which is the minimum length.

How to fix a sagging ceiling in a mobile home?

A ceiling with slight sagging may be corrected by wetting the tile with a spray bottle and water, pushing the ceiling board back to its original position. Use a board screwed to the ceiling to hold the position for several days until the ceiling tile is completely dry.
